2022 Lincoln Nautilus Reviews Summary

The 2022 Lincoln Nautilus is a five-passenger crossover SUV based on the same platform, and using the same powertrains, as the Ford Edge. However, the Nautilus gets the full Lincoln design treatment, from its upscale exterior to its mid-century modern interior. Though the Nautilus is getting old (it was last redesigned for the 2016 model year as the Lincoln MKX), a continuous program of improvement means it is aging gracefully.

2023 Hyundai Santa Fe Reviews Summary

Hyundai's two-row midsize SUV carries over nearly unchanged for 2023, save for some minor equipment shuffling and a sprinkle of additional horsepower for the base engine. Beyond that, the Santa Fe continues to deliver class-leading value in terms of pricing, standard safety features, and technology. For those looking to maximize fuel economy, the Santa Fe also comes in a hybrid version. The Santa Fe slots into Hyundai’s SUV line-up above the subcompact Kona and compact Tucson, and below the Palisade mid-size three-row SUV.

Look and feel

2022 Lincoln Nautilus

8/10

2023 Hyundai Santa Fe

6/10

The 2022 Lincoln Nautilus was a visually appealing SUV, striking a balance between elegance and character without appearing overly plain. Its design was well-proportioned, and Lincoln's attention to detail ensured the Nautilus had a distinctive presence. At night, the Lincoln Embrace lighting sequence added a touch of sophistication. Inside, the test vehicle featured light grey premium leather upholstery, with other interior colour options available, such as sandstone, dark brown, and black. However, the centre console design and some chrome-plated plastic elements detracted slightly from the overall luxurious feel.

In contrast, the 2023 Hyundai Santa Fe's exterior styling was more conservative compared to some of Hyundai's recent designs, yet it remained an attractive SUV. The Santa Fe maintained the same look as the 2022 model, with a wide upper and lower grille and thin LED headlights as its distinctive features. The test vehicle, an Ultimate Calligraphy trim, had a black interior with leather seats, which, while high-quality, appeared somewhat dark and monotone. The Nappa leather seats were comfortable and visually appealing, and the cabin offered a range of interior colour options to provide visual contrast.

Performance

2022 Lincoln Nautilus

8/10

2023 Hyundai Santa Fe

7/10

The 2022 Lincoln Nautilus came standard with a turbocharged 2.0-litre four-cylinder engine, delivering 250 horsepower and 280 pound-feet of torque, paired with an 8-speed automatic transmission and all-wheel drive in Canada. An optional twin-turbocharged 2.7-litre V6 engine was available, producing 335 hp and 380 lb-ft of torque. The Nautilus offered Comfort, Normal, and Sport driving modes, which adjusted powertrain behaviour, steering effort, and adaptive suspension. The V6 engine, combined with the adaptive suspension, provided a smooth and comfortable ride, although the steering lacked engagement. The Nautilus averaged 9.4 L/100 km over 1,400 kilometres, with a maximum range of 730 kilometres on the highway.

The 2023 Hyundai Santa Fe offered a 2.5-litre engine, with a choice between naturally aspirated and turbocharged versions. The naturally aspirated engine produced 191 horsepower and 181 pound-feet of torque, while the turbocharged version delivered 281 hp and 311 pound-feet. The turbocharged engine, paired with an eight-speed "wet" dual-clutch automatic transmission, provided brisk acceleration and smooth handling. The Santa Fe featured four drive modes: Comfort, Sport, Snow, and Smart. The turbocharged version offered a significant performance boost, with immediate acceleration and passing power, while maintaining a quiet and smooth ride.

Form and function

2022 Lincoln Nautilus

7/10

2023 Hyundai Santa Fe

8/10

The 2022 Lincoln Nautilus featured a luxurious interior with smooth leather, ambient lighting, and a quiet drive. The front seats were heated and ventilated, with optional 22-way power adjustments for added comfort. However, the rear seating was cramped for a midsize SUV, with limited legroom. The Nautilus offered 1,055 litres of cargo space behind the rear seat and 1,948 litres with the seats folded down. Storage space was adequate but not exceptional, with some compartments difficult to access.

The 2023 Hyundai Santa Fe, with its two-row configuration, provided ample rear-seat legroom of 1,060 millimetres and competitive cargo space of 1,032 litres behind the second row, expanding to 2,041 litres with the seats folded. The Santa Fe offered comfortable seating, with standard heated front seats and dual-zone climate control. The Ultimate Calligraphy trim included features like a hands-free smart liftgate, ventilated front seats, and a head-up display. However, the wide centre console slightly reduced driver leg and hip space.

Technology

2022 Lincoln Nautilus

8/10

2023 Hyundai Santa Fe

9/10

The 2022 Lincoln Nautilus was equipped with a 12.3-inch digital instrumentation display and a 13.2-inch touchscreen infotainment system running Sync 4 software. It offered over-the-air updates, w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to, a Wi-Fi hotspot, and a 19-speaker Revel audio system. The system was intuitive, with physical stereo and climate controls, and the Phone as a Key feature allowed smartphone access to the vehicle.

The 2023 Hyundai Santa Fe featured a 10.25-inch touchscreen with navigation, wired Apple CarPlay and Android Auto, and a 12-speaker Harman Kardon audio system in the Ultimate Calligraphy trim. The infotainment system was user-friendly, with customizable settings and voice recognition capabilities. However, the voice-recognition system had mixed results, particularly with music and temperature commands. The Ultimate Calligraphy trim also included wireless device charging and a 12.3-inch digital instrument cluster.

Safety

2022 Lincoln Nautilus

8/10

2023 Hyundai Santa Fe

9/10

The 2022 Lincoln Nautilus came with the Lincoln Co-Pilot360 1.0 suite, including forward-collision warning, automatic emergency braking, blind-spot monitoring, and lane-keeping assist. The Black Label trim added adaptive cruise control, lane-centring assistance, and a surround-view camera system. The Nautilus received a five-star overall rating from the NHTSA and was a Top Safety Pick by the IIHS.

The 2023 Hyundai Santa Fe offered a comprehensive suite of safety features, including forward-collision avoidance, blind-spot monitoring, lane-keeping assist, and a rear-seat reminder system. The Ultimate Calligraphy trim included Highway Driving Assist and adaptive cruise control. The Santa Fe received a five-star overall rating from the NHTSA and was a Top Safety Pick+ by the IIHS.

CarGurus highlights

Winning Vehicle Image

According to CarGurus experts, the overall rating for the 2022 Lincoln Nautilus is 7.8 out of 10, while the 2023 Hyundai Santa Fe scores 8.2 out of 10. Based on these ratings, the 2023 Hyundai Santa Fe is the recommended choice, offering a better balance of performance, safety, and technology features at a competitive price point.

Choose the 2022 Lincoln Nautilus if:

7.8of 10overall
  • You prefer a luxurious interior with premium materials and ambient lighting.
  • You value a powerful twin-turbocharged V6 engine for a smooth and comfortable ride.
  • You appreciate advanced technology features like Phone as a Key and a Revel audio system.

Choose the 2023 Hyundai Santa Fe if:

8.2of 10overall
  • You need ample rear-seat legroom and competitive cargo space for family trips.
  • You want a comprehensive suite of safety features and a Top Safety Pick+ rating.
  • You prefer a user-friendly infotainment system with customizable settings.
